Understanding the Mechanics of Plinko

The fundamental principle of plinko is elegantly simple. A disc or puck, typically made of glass or a similar material, is released from the top of a vertically oriented board. This board is populated with rows of evenly spaced pegs. As the puck descends, it bounces off these pegs in a seemingly random manner, altering its trajectory with each impact. The final destination of the puck – the slot at the bottom of the board – determines the payout received by the player. The arrangement of the pegs, their density, and the overall board design all contribute to the game's inherent variability and unpredictable nature. Understanding this basic structure is crucial before delving into any strategies.

The Role of Randomness and Probability

While seemingly chaotic, plinko is governed by the laws of probability. Each peg impact represents a 50/50 chance of the puck veering left or right. However, the cumulative effect of multiple deflections quickly makes predicting the final outcome incredibly difficult. Despite this randomness, certain slots at the bottom of the board tend to receive more pucks than others, based on their position relative to the starting point and the arrangement of the pegs. Recognizing these potential hotspots, and understanding how subtle variations in the peg layout can influence the puck's path, is a key element of successful gameplay. It isn’t about controlling the randomness; it’s about understanding it.

Variations in Modern Plinko Games

While the classic plinko board remains a popular sight in casinos, modern iterations of the game have emerged, often incorporating digital elements and innovative features. Online plinko games, for instance, frequently utilize random number generators (RNGs) to simulate the puck's descent and ensure fairness. These digital versions often offer customizable settings, allowing players to adjust the board's complexity and payout structures. Some modern plinko games also incorporate bonus rounds or special features, adding an extra layer of excitement and strategic depth.
